What is full stack web development?

Full Stack Web Development refers to the practice of working on both the front-end (client side) and back-end (server side) of web applications. Full Stack Developers are skilled in technologies like HTML, CSS, JavaScript for front-end development, as well as languages such as Python, Ruby, Java, PHP, or Node.js for back-end development. They also work with databases, servers, APIs, and version control systems. The role requires a broad understanding of how web applications function as a whole, enabling developers to build and maintain complete, functional websites and web applications.

What are some common challenges full stack web developers face when balancing front-end and back-end responsibilities?

Full Stack Web Developers often encounter the challenge of context-switching between front-end and back-end tasks, which can require different skill sets and approaches. Managing time efficiently to address both user interface concerns and server-side logic is crucial, especially in fast-paced environments where priorities can shift quickly. Additionally, staying updated with evolving frameworks and best practices on both ends of the stack can be demanding, but it's essential for delivering cohesive, high-quality applications. Collaboration with designers, product managers, and other developers is also key to ensuring all layers of the application align with project go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full stack web develop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Stack Web Developer, you need strong proficiency in both front-end (HTML, CSS, JavaScript) and back-end (such as Node.js, Python, or Ruby) technologies, often supported by a relevant degree or coding bootcamp. Familiarity with frameworks like React or Angular, databases (SQL/NoSQL), version control systems (Git), and cloud platforms is typically expected. Excellent problem-solving, adaptability, and collaboration skills help you manage complex projects and communicate effectively with team members. These skills ensure the delivery of robust, scalable, and user-friendly web applications that meet client and business needs.

What is the difference between Full Stack Web Development vs Front End Developer?

AspectFull Stack Web DeveloperFront End Developer
SkillsProficient in both front-end and back-end technologies, including HTML, CSS, JavaScript, server-side languages, and databases.Specializes in client-side technologies like H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and frameworks like React or Angular.
Work EnvironmentWorks on both server and client sides, often involved in full project development.Focuses primarily on designing and implementing user interfaces and user experience.
Common UsageUsed in startups and small teams requiring versatile developers.Common in larger teams with specialized roles, focusing on UI/UX design.

Full Stack Web Developers have a broader skill set covering both front-end and back-end development, enabling them to handle entire projects. Front End Developers specialize in creating engaging user interfaces. The choice depends on project needs and team structure.
